**Vendor note: Inkmill markdown pipeline**

Rendering for Parchway docs is outsourced to Inkmill under an annual contract, renewing each March. They handle sanitization and PDF export; we own the upload queue. SLA: 4-hour response on rendering failures. Escalate only after two failed retries. Their support desk is reachable at the address below.

billing contact of hahaf-baguf = zorael.tammir.jorius@sivrelhq.internal

Capacity note for the Mossvale digest sender: we currently fan out roughly 1.2M digest emails across a four-hour morning window, and the queue drains fine, but the planned Brightharbor launch doubles recipients. Rather than widening the window, we'll raise per-worker batch size and add a second dispatch wave, keeping SMTP connection counts under the relay ceiling. Reviewers should check that the scheduler math stays consistent with retry backoff. Current scheduling constants for the dispatcher are as follows.

tuning table, yajog-yahof:
BUDGETS = {
    "lamvan": 303,
    "wenox": 460,
    "fenvan": 525,
}

### Step 3: Enable export retries

Failed exports in Ledgerline previously required manual replay. This step wires the new retry worker into the export pipeline. Review notes: retries are idempotent — each export carries a dedupe token, so duplicate delivery is safe. Backoff is exponential with a hard cap; poison messages land in the quarantine queue after the final attempt. No schema changes. Apply the worker manifest, then confirm it picks up the configuration values below.

config for kajog-tadug:
[casax]
port = 11211
region = west-3
host = casax.nelvroworks.internal
timeout_ms = 5000
retries = 7

Onboarding note for the Ledgerpane admin table: bulk edits are applied through the batcher service, not directly against the database. Select rows, choose an action, and the batcher stages changes in a pending set you can review before commit. Edits over 500 rows require a second approver — this is enforced server-side, so don't try to chunk around it. To run the batcher locally you need the staging write credential, which goes in your .env as the next line.

secret setting of bahip-kagag: RELAY_SECRET3=c83